Fire alarm at train station with haze and propane smellElizabethtown PA

audio iconFire & Arson
Parking lot, 50 S Wilson Ave, Elizabethtown, PA 17022

A fire alarm was activated at the train station near South Wilson Avenue. Responders found haze inside and a strong propane smell outside, about 50 feet from the building. No fire was visible and no one was believed inside. A possible electrical issue was noted.
